Topic: Kluson Deluxe / Ric Deluxe??
Replies: 5
Views: 2313

Re: Kluson Deluxe / Ric Deluxe??

Replacement part IMO. The Ric deluxe came around in about 1990 with the John Lennon and late run RM. The early RM had the Schaller deluxe.

Topic: Greetings from WI newbie
Replies: 8
Views: 2537

Re: Greetings from WI newbie

Joseph welcome aboard. I believe the nut width on a Fender and Rickenbacker are the same, 1 5/8. But a Fender is wider as you progress down, so wider at the 12th fret is the usual measurement cited. Gibson is wider at the nut, 1 3/4. But this is all from memory so could be wrong.
